Adjust picture and sound settings
Picture and sound settings are preset
from the factory to neutral values
which suit most viewing and listening
situations. However, if you wish, you
can adjust these settings to your liking.
Adjust picture brightness, colour or
contrast. Sound settings include volume,
bass and treble.
Store your picture and sound settings
temporarily – until your television is
switched off – or store them
permanently.

Change brightness, colour or contrast
Adjust the picture settings via the PICTURE
menu. Temporary settings are cancelled
when you switch off the television.
> Press
TV to switch on the television.
> Press MENU to bring up the TV SETUP menu
and press to highlight PICTURE.
> Press GO to bring up the PICTURE menu.
> Press or to move through menu items.
> Press or to adjust the values.
> Press EXIT to store your settings until you
switch off the television, or …
> … press GO to store your settings permanently.
To temporarily remove the picture from the screen,
press LIST repeatedly to display P.MUTE on Beo4,
then press GO. To restore the picture again, press
any source button, such as TV.
What’s on the PICTURE menu …
BRIGHTNESS … Adjusts the picture brightness.
CONTRAST … Adjusts the contrast level in the
picture.
COLOUR … Adjusts the colour intensity in the
picture.
TINT … Adjusts the colour shade or nuance on the
current channel. Only available for video sources
using the NTSC signal.
If a source, such as PC, is connected via the VGA
socket, the following options appear ...
HOR. SIZE … Adjusts the width of the picture.
HOR. POSITION … Adjusts the position of the
picture horizontally.
VERT. POSITION … Adjusts the position of the
picture vertically.
